Estoy intentando generar una señal de cuadratura con un L297 enlace Uso solo las fases A y C para tener un desplazamiento de 90 °
Here is my wiring:
// L297 -> MCU
2 GND -> GND
4 A -> read out phase A
7 C -> read out phase C
10 ENABLE -> GPIO Pin 1
12 Vs - +5v
11 Control -> GPIO Pin 5 set to high for phases line ABCD
17 CW/CCW -> GPIO Pin 2 set to high or low depeding the direction
18 Clock -> GPIO Pin 3
19 Half/Full -> GPIO Pin 6 set to low for full step
20 RST -> +5v
Según mi entendimiento, cuando quiero que se ejecute el L297, escribo un poco en GPIO Pin 1 (ALTO) para habilitar el L297 Para cambiar de dirección, debo poner Pin 2 Alto o Bajo Y cuando quiero enviar un pulso, escribo un poco en Pin 3 / Reloj Estoy enviando el pulso al reloj, pero los canales A y C permanecen siempre bajos. ¿Tiene alguna idea de lo que podría salir mal con mi cableado? o con mi entendimiento?
Gracias